The question of the best stamina class for PvP in The Elder Scrolls Online (ESO) is hotly debated. However, based on current meta trends, overall versatility, and potential for both burst damage and sustained pressure, the Stamina Dragonknight (StamDK) emerges as a top contender, closely followed by Stamina Nightblade (StamNB) and Stamina Sorcerer (StamSorc). While the StamDK offers unmatched resource sustain, potent DoT pressure, and a game-changing ultimate, the StamNB excels in burst damage and stealthy gameplay, while the StamSorc brings mobility and surprisingly high damage. The best choice ultimately depends on your preferred playstyle.

Delving Deeper: Examining the Top Contenders

Let’s break down why each of these classes is so strong and what they bring to the PvP arena.

Stamina Dragonknight: The Resilient Juggernaut

The StamDK is renowned for its amazing resource management, allowing for prolonged engagements and constant pressure. Key class skills like Burning Embers provide strong damage over time (DoT) and self-healing. The Stonefist ability offers mobility and a stun, making it effective for both offense and defense. The class ultimate, Dragon Leap, is arguably the best in the game for securing kills and controlling the battlefield.

  • Strengths: Exceptional sustain, strong DoT pressure, powerful ultimate, good survivability, ease of play.
  • Weaknesses: Can be predictable, less burst potential than other classes.
  • Playstyle: A brawler that thrives in prolonged fights, applying constant pressure and overwhelming opponents with attrition.

Stamina Nightblade: The Shadowy Assassin

The StamNB is the master of burst damage and stealth. Relying on surprise attacks and swift executions, this class can quickly eliminate unsuspecting enemies. Skills like Surprise Attack provide a significant damage boost and apply a debuff to the target. Killer’s Blade allows for executing low-health enemies, while Shadow Cloak offers stealth and survivability.

  • Strengths: High burst damage, excellent mobility, strong stealth capabilities, good at picking off isolated targets.
  • Weaknesses: Reliant on surprise attacks, vulnerable when caught out of position, requires skillful resource management.
  • Playstyle: An assassin that excels at flanking, ambushing, and quickly eliminating key targets.

Stamina Sorcerer: The Mobile Menace

The StamSorc has evolved into a potent force in PvP, known for its mobility and surprising damage output. The class skill Hurricane provides significant area-of-effect (AoE) damage and movement speed. StamSorc’s also have strong self heals due to skills like Critical Surge. Furthermore, StamSorc has access to strong damage shields, making them more tanky. The Streak ability provides unmatched mobility, allowing the StamSorc to quickly engage or disengage from fights.

  • Strengths: High mobility, good burst and sustained damage, self-healing, access to strong shields
  • Weaknesses: Can be resource intensive, more complicated to master, less sustain compared to StamDK.
  • Playstyle: A highly mobile skirmisher that can quickly engage and disengage, applying pressure with AoE damage and burst potential.

Other Viable Options

While the StamDK, StamNB, and StamSorc are considered top tier, other stamina classes can also be effective in PvP with the right build and playstyle. The Stamina Warden (Stamden) offers good healing, utility, and burst damage. The Stamina Templar (Stamplar) provides excellent burst potential and strong healing capabilities. The Stamina Necromancer (Stamcro) offers a unique playstyle with strong AoE damage and corpse management. And, finally the Stamina Arcanist (StamAr) utilizes its beams and portals to decimate the competition.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is the best race for a Stamina PvP character?

The best race depends on your class and build, but some top options include:

  • Orc: Provides increased weapon damage and stamina, making it a strong choice for any stamina class.
  • Redguard: Offers excellent stamina sustain, beneficial for classes that rely heavily on stamina abilities.
  • Khajiit: Provides increased critical hit damage and stamina recovery, making it a good choice for burst-damage builds.
  • Dark Elf (Dunmer): Offers a balance of stamina and magicka, making it versatile for hybrid builds.
  • Wood Elf (Bosmer): Stamina and stealth bonuses make this a solid choice for nightblades.

2. What are the essential skills for a Stamina Dragonknight PvP build?

Key skills include:

  • Burning Embers: DoT and self-heal.
  • Stonefist: Mobility and stun.
  • Venomous Claw: DoT.
  • Noxious Breath: AoE damage and debuff.
  • Dragon Leap: Powerful ultimate.
  • Igneous Weapons: Weapon damage buff.
  • Resolving Vigor: Strong Stamina heal.

3. What gear sets are popular for Stamina Nightblades in PvP?

Popular sets include:

  • Essence Thief: Sustain and burst.
  • Spriggan’s Thorns: Penetration for increased damage.
  • Hunding’s Rage: Weapon damage.
  • Deadly Strike: Increased damage to DoTs.
  • Balorgh: Weapon and Spell damage after using Ultimate.
  • Kra’gh: Weapon and Spell penetration on proc.

4. How do I manage my stamina effectively in PvP?

  • Use weapon enchants.
  • Heavy attack enemies when they are off balance.
  • Use skills that restore stamina, such as Potions, Rally, and the Weapon Master passive.
  • Invest in stamina recovery enchants on jewelry.
  • Use the The Serpent mundus stone for additional stamina recovery.

5. What is the best mundus stone for a Stamina PvP build?

The best mundus stone depends on your build and preferences, but some popular options include:

  • The Serpent: Increases stamina recovery.
  • The Thief: Increases critical hit chance.
  • The Warrior: Increases weapon damage.

6. What is the best food buff for Stamina PvP?

  • Dubious Throne: Max health, stamina, and stamina recovery.
  • Artaeum Takeaway Broth: Max health, stamina, and stamina recovery.
  • Lava Foot Soup-and-Saltrice: Max health and stamina recovery.

7. How important is penetration in PvP?

Penetration is crucial for overcoming enemy armor and increasing your damage output. Aim for around 8,000 penetration to effectively damage most players.

8. Should I focus on weapon damage or critical hit chance in PvP?

A balance of both is ideal. Weapon damage increases your overall damage output, while critical hit chance increases the frequency of critical hits, which deal increased damage.

9. What is the best armor trait for PvP?

Impenetrable is the best armor trait for PvP, as it reduces damage taken from critical hits. Well-Fitted is another great option.

10. How do I counter a Stamina Nightblade in PvP?

  • Use detection potions to reveal them in stealth.
  • Stay with your group to avoid being picked off.
  • Use crowd control abilities to interrupt their attacks.
  • Build for high resistances.

11. What is the role of a Stamina Warden in PvP?

Stamina Wardens excel at providing support, healing, and burst damage. They can also be effective tanks with the right build.

12. How do I improve my survivability in PvP?

  • Wear heavy armor.
  • Use skills that provide healing and damage shields.
  • Increase your health and resistances.
  • Practice good positioning and awareness.
  • Use potions.

13. What is the best way to practice PvP?

  • Participate in Battlegrounds and Cyrodiil.
  • Duel other players.
  • Watch experienced PvP players and learn from their strategies.
  • Experiment with different builds and playstyles.

14. How does Champion Point distribution affect my Stamina PvP build?

Champion Points (CP) can significantly enhance your build. Focus on allocating CP to increase your damage, survivability, and resource sustain. For example, you may want to increase weapon damage, crit damage, or defense against crits. Experiment to find out the best allocation for your playstyle.
